Fanshawe Crescent is in Dagenham and in Barking And Dagenham district. RM9 5DL is located in the Parsloes elect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Barking.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Fanshawe Crescent was 55.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 48.0% lower than the Alibon average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.
Fanshawe Crescent has the 22nd lowest crime rate of 64 local areas in Alibon and the 144th lowest crime rate of 521 local areas in Barking and Dagenham .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 9.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 55.0%.

Households in this area have a slightly lower level of wealth to the average household in England and Wales. 65% of analyzed areas in England and Wales have higher average household annual income than this area.
